Port Loopback Test
Pressing <Enter> while Port Loopback Test is selected displays a reminder to
take the Switch offline, if it is not offline. If the message is displayed, take the
Switch offline as described in section Switch Offline.
The Port Loopback Test is an internal test which continues to run until you
press any button. This test checks all of the Switch’s internal firmware and
circuitry including the Switch’s G_Port and FL_Port ASICs.
While the test is running, all interface module front panel LEDs rapidly flicker
green indicating that the test is finding no errors and is processing.
To stop the test, press any button, Aborted is displayed:

Cross Port Test
The Cross Port Test checks communication between different interface
module ports on the same Switch, the Switch’s G_Port and FL_Port ASIC and
CPU, the interface modules and their GBIC modules. A Switch setup to run
this test must have all ports on the Switch interconnected, as shown in Figure
2-2. G_Ports must connect to
G_Ports
and
FL_Ports
must connect to FL_Ports.
